## **Core Concept**
The pea-orbital view, also known as the occipitomental view or Waters' view, is a radiographic projection used primarily in the field of otolaryngology and maxillofacial surgery. This specific radiographic view is crucial for assessing the **paranasal sinuses**, particularly the **maxillary sinuses**. It helps in visualizing the bony structures and air-filled cavities of the face.

The maxillary sinuses are the largest of the paranasal sinuses and are located in the maxillary bones. The pea-orbital or Waters' view is taken with the X-ray beam angled so that the petrous ridge is projected below the floor of the maxillary sinus, allowing for an unobstructed view of these sinuses. This is particularly useful for diagnosing conditions such as **maxillary sinusitis**, fractures of the **zygomatic bone**, and **antrolithiasis**.

## **Clinical Pearl / High-Yield Fact**
A key clinical pearl is that the Waters' view (pea-orbital view) is essential in the initial assessment of **facial trauma**, particularly for evaluating **zygomatic arch** fractures and **maxillary sinus** involvement. Clinicians should always consider the possibility of associated injuries, such as **orbital floor fractures**, when interpreting these radiographs.
